“Don’t Sell Your Votes Less Than $50,000” – Former Gombe Governor

Former Governor of Gombe State, Ibrahim Dankwambo has advised voters against selling their votes for an unreasonable price.
Ibrahim said if voters must sell their votes, then they should accept only $50,000 and above.

The PDP chieftain noted this while speaking on the 2023 general elections and decisions to be taken by youths who intend to vote, he also encouraged Nigerian students who are currently at home due to the ongoing ASUU strike to troop out and vote ‘right’ on election day.

He said;
”The worth of your vote should be around $50,000 Fifty (Thousand Dollars). If you will ever sell your vote, that should be your starting price.
Do all you can to vote for candidate that will protect you, build a strong economy and unite the country.
To all the students who are first-time voters and have stayed home for months due to ASUU strike, it’s time to vote right.”
